to create stronger connections and relationships We are profoundly social creatures. A sense of social connection is one of our fundamental human needs. We may think we want money, power, fame, beauty, or eternal youth, but at the root of most of these desires is a need to belong, to be accepted, to connect with others, to love and be loved. Numerous studies claim that strong relationships improve physical health and emotional well-being. They strengthen our immune system, help us recover from disease faster, and may even lengthen our life. People who feel more connected to others have lower rates of anxiety and depression, as well as higher self-esteem and are more empathic to others. Unfortunately, in today&#8217;s society, we tend to have shallow, superficial relationships with others. Often they are unfulfilling because they lack real strength as they lack real depth. Even though technology has made it easier to communicate, it has not made it easier to connect with other human beings. And it takes time and effort to develop and maintain genuine, authentic relationships. In this high-tech, fast-paced world we live in, a few small things done the old-fashioned way may create stronger connections and relationships. Give it a try. Tips on how to create stronger connections and relationships . Answer questions with honesty rather than abstraction When someone asks \u201aHow was your weekend?&#8217;, don&#8217;t answer with \u201agood&#8217;, if it was the best weekend in a long time, you met someone incredible or saw something astonishingly beautiful. If you want to connect with people, then you have to open up. It stands out, as most of us are not open. . Video conference over a phone call That is when you can see the real personality come out. When you are on video, you must be present. It is a forcing mechanism to be in the moment, and you need to be present. . Talk about the things that matter to you. Give others a chance to know what you care about and what you believe in. If they believe in the same things as you do, they will let you know. Thus you will find meaningful common ground to feel more connected. . Express vulnerability. Humans connect with other humans, not with ideals. Hiding your flaws may show cold and impersonal, which, as a result, makes it very hard for anyone to connect with emotionally. . Be present and listen. People are attracted to good empathic listeners. Empathic listening is when we put any distraction, our need to control and beliefs as to how things \u201ashould&#8217; be aside and attend fully to the person we are listening to. No interruption, no judgement, no advice unless specifically asked. . Respect differences People&#8217;s view of the world and how to live it may not be the same as ours. When you accept individuality and the right to your own opinion, people start responding to you and connect to you as a result. . Be thankful Everyone you encounter in your everyday life is impacting you in some way, and you should be thankful for that. Appreciate all your co-workers do for you on the job, your family does at home, what your friends do to make you smile. Sources for helping to deepen relationships #1 \/\/ Have a better conversation. Listen to the response. Follow up with a statement (ideally an open-ended statement \u2014 but not another question). #6 \/\/ Foster closeness by the mutual vulnerability. Grab a partner &#8211; friend, lover,&nbsp; or stranger &#8211; and get ready to get intimate. In Mandy Len Catron\u2019s Modern Love essay, \u201cTo Fall in Love With Anyone, Do This,\u201d she refers to a study by the psychologist Arthur Aron (and others) that explores whether intimacy between two strangers can be accelerated by having them ask each other a specific series of personal questions. The 36 questions in the study are broken up into three sets, with each set intended to be more probing than the previous one.
